Understanding the Importance of CRM Software
CRM software serves as a central hub for managing customer interactions and data. Here’s why investing in a robust CRM solution is essential for any modern business:
- Enhanced Customer Relations: CRM systems allow businesses to track customer interactions, preferences, and feedback, leading to personalized service and improved satisfaction.
- Streamlined Processes: Automation of repetitive tasks frees up time for marketing teams to focus on strategy rather than administrative duties.
- Data Security and Compliance: Keeping customer data secure and adhering to regulations is easier with dedicated CRM systems.
- Actionable Insights: Advanced analytics features provide valuable insights into customer behavior and preferences, enabling data-driven decision-making.
Key Features to Look for in a Marketing CRM
When evaluating CRM software options for marketing, several key features should be prioritized:
1. Integration Capabilities
The ability to integrate with existing tools such as email marketing platforms, social media, and e-commerce systems is vital for a seamless workflow.
2. Automation Tools
Look for CRMs with built-in marketing automation features that can manage campaigns, track engagement, and nurture leads without manual intervention.
3. Analytics and Reporting
The best CRM systems come equipped with comprehensive reporting tools to analyze campaign effectiveness and customer interactions.
4. User-Friendly Interface
An intuitive design ensures that all team members can easily navigate the system, reducing the learning curve and increasing productivity.
5. Scalability
Choose a CRM that can grow with your business, offering additional features and user licenses as needed.
Top CRM Software Picks for 2025
Based on the above criteria, here are the top CRM software picks for marketing professionals in 2025:
1. Salesforce
Salesforce remains a leader in the CRM space, offering unparalleled customization options and integrations. Key features include:
- Robust marketing automation capabilities
- Advanced analytics and reporting tools
- Extensive third-party app integrations
- User-friendly interface with customizable dashboards
2. HubSpot CRM
HubSpot CRM is well-loved for its free tier, which provides essential features for small to medium-sized businesses. Highlights include:
- Seamless integration with HubSpot’s marketing tools
- User-friendly layout, perfect for beginners
- Customization options for tracking leads and sales
- In-depth reporting and analytics
3. Zoho CRM
Ideal for businesses of all sizes, Zoho CRM focuses on customization and automation. It features:
- AI-driven insights and suggestions
- Flexible pricing plans
- Comprehensive set of integrations
- Lead scoring and segmentation tools
4. Pipedrive
Pipedrive is designed for sales management but offers excellent CRM capabilities for marketing teams. Its features include:
- Visual sales pipeline management
- Activity reminders and automation
- Customizable reporting and analytics
- Integration with various marketing tools
5. Microsoft Dynamics 365
This solution is particularly advantageous for businesses already using Microsoft products. Key features include:
- Deep integration with Microsoft Office Suite
- Scalable solutions tailored to specific industries
- Advanced analytics powered by AI
- Robust security features
Comparative Table of Top CRM Software
| CRM Software | Key Features | Best For |
|---|---|---|
| Salesforce | Customization, automation, analytics | Larger enterprises |
| HubSpot CRM | Free tier, user-friendly, integrations | Small to medium-sized businesses |
| Zoho CRM | AI insights, flexible pricing, lead scoring | All business sizes |
| Pipedrive | Visual pipelines, activity automation | Sales-focused teams |
| Microsoft Dynamics 365 | Microsoft integration, industry solutions | Companies using Microsoft tools |
Evaluating Your CRM Needs
Before choosing the right CRM for your marketing team, consider the following steps:
- Assess Your Current Processes: Identify what challenges you face in customer relationship management.
- Define Your Goals: Set clear objectives for what you aim to achieve with a CRM.
- Involve Your Team: Gather feedback from all team members who will use the CRM.
- Test Multiple Solutions: Most CRM providers offer free trials—take advantage of these to find the best fit.

What is the average cost of marketing CRM software in 2025?
The average cost of marketing CRM software in 2025 varies widely based on features and user count, ranging from free plans to monthly subscriptions of $50 to $300 or more per user.
